The growth hormone releasing peptide, in plain words
As you age, your body’s natural production of vital hormones can decline. This often leads to reduced energy, poorer sleep quality, and changes in body composition. A specific compounded prescription acts as a secretagogue, gently prompting your body to release more of its own growth hormone.
This therapy functions as a GHRH analog, stimulating your pituitary gland. It encourages a more natural, pulsatile release of human growth hormone (hGH). This physiological approach often avoids the tachyphylaxis sometimes associated with direct hGH administration.
The primary goal is to elevate insulin-like growth factor 1 (IGF-1) levels, which are crucial for cellular repair and regeneration. This internal cascade of events supports various bodily functions. It helps optimize your body’s inherent restorative processes.

What is the difference between this therapy and HGH
This compounded prescription encourages your own pituitary gland to release growth hormone in a natural, pulsatile manner. Direct hGH therapy, by contrast, introduces exogenous growth hormone into your system. The former method is often preferred for its more physiological approach, which may reduce the risk of tachyphylaxis or desensitization over time. It optimizes your body’s intrinsic capabilities.
How is this compounded prescription administered
The therapy involves a simple, subcutaneous injection. You administer it yourself, typically using a very fine needle, similar to insulin injections. Your clinician will provide clear instructions and support for proper administration, making the process straightforward and easy to learn.
